13.2 WHO TAKES THE KICK-OFF AND RESTART KICK
(a) At the start of the game, the team whose captain elected to take the kick after winning the toss will kick off, or the opposing team if the winning captain elected to choose an end.
(b) After the half-time interval, the opponents of the team who kicked off at the start of the game kick off.
(c) After a score the opponents of the team who scored restart play.
